"God I hate public transport," Darius said. His eyes were on the old war veterans, the families with their screaming children and the not-so-successful businessman. "We work for the wealthiest company on Earth, what are we doing riding on a ferry with the undesirables of society?" he said to his human partner. "This is our row here" Jackson said, apparently ignoring him. They squeezed into the compacted space, muttering apologies to those they had to move by. When they had finally sat down in their seats, Jackson pulled out his agency-issued portable computer and plugged earphones into it, slightly nodding his head to some old Earth rock tune. "Jackson," Darius said, slightly annoyed. The human took one earphone out and looked at him inquisitively. "I asked you a question." "Yes, you did didn't you?" Jackson replied, taking out his other earphone. "It's little wonder you're still a B-level agent, Mercer. You don't use your head." Darius bristled at that but didn't retort, patiently waiting for him to elaborate instead. That was the thing with Jackson, he'll end up telling you things you want to hear because he always loved to appear clever. It was one of his many character flaws. "Think about it Mercer, we're going to the planet Frieza where the Planetary Trade Organisation have spies anywhere. Especially at space ports; they want to know who's coming in and out of their planet after all. And it pretty much is their planet, King Chill is just a puppet playing to the whims of the upper echelons of the PTO. If we attempt to land on their planet with a Capsule Corporation ship, they're going to blast us out the sky before we even get into atmosphere. It's more secure this way and at least we know we aren't going to get turned into space dust." Yes, Darius saw now. He should have thought of it himself. Perhaps Jackson was right, his encounter with his brother had left him a little dazed and more than a little purposeless. His entire adult life had been dedicated to searching for him and now that he had found him and had been rejected, he didn't know what he wanted to do with his life any more. This job with Capsule Corp. was just that: a job. He didn't feel any particular allegiance to the Northern Alliance or any enmity towards the Tuffle Legion. As far as he was concerned, the war didn't concern him all that much. On the other hand, working for Capsule Corp. was better than doing nothing at all. He'd finish this next mission then rethink his life. As the ship did its tour of the North Galaxy, people got off at various stops. Darius passed the days making small talk with Jackson and some of the other passengers or researching aspects of his assignment on his computer. He had never been to Frieza before, most of his previous work with Capsule Corp. had been on either Earth or Vegeta. A brand new planet, all those unknowns. Darius didn't like it.
